What is the Quitclaim Deed Three Individuals To One Individual New Hampshire
A quitclaim deed is a legal document that allows one party to transfer their interest in a property to another party without making any guarantees about the title. In the context of three individuals transferring their interests to one individual in New Hampshire, this document serves to clarify ownership and can be particularly useful in situations such as family transfers or settling estates. The quitclaim deed does not provide warranties regarding the property title, meaning the grantee accepts the property "as is." This type of deed is often used when the parties know each other and trust that the transfer is valid.
Steps to Complete the Quitclaim Deed Three Individuals To One Individual New Hampshire
Completing a quitclaim deed in New Hampshire involves several key steps:
- Gather necessary information, including the names and addresses of all parties involved, a legal description of the property, and the date of transfer.
- Obtain a quitclaim deed form, which can be found online or at local government offices.
- Fill out the form accurately, ensuring that all names are spelled correctly and the property description is precise.
- Have all parties sign the deed in the presence of a notary public to ensure its validity.
- File the completed deed with the local registry of deeds in New Hampshire to make the transfer official.
Legal Use of the Quitclaim Deed Three Individuals To One Individual New Hampshire
In New Hampshire, the quitclaim deed is legally recognized for transferring property interests. It is commonly used for various purposes, including family transfers, divorce settlements, or clearing up title issues. However, it is important to understand that while the quitclaim deed transfers the interest of the grantors, it does not guarantee that the title is free of liens or encumbrances. The grantee assumes the risk associated with the property title. Therefore, conducting a title search before completing the transfer is advisable to ensure clarity and avoid future disputes.
Key Elements of the Quitclaim Deed Three Individuals To One Individual New Hampshire
Several key elements must be included in a quitclaim deed to ensure its effectiveness:
- Names of the Grantors and Grantee: Clearly identify all parties involved in the transaction.
- Legal Description of the Property: Provide a detailed description of the property being transferred, including boundaries.
- Consideration: State any payment or consideration involved in the transfer, even if it is nominal.
- Signatures: All grantors must sign the deed in the presence of a notary public.
- Notarization: A notary's acknowledgment is necessary to validate the deed.
State-Specific Rules for the Quitclaim Deed Three Individuals To One Individual New Hampshire
New Hampshire has specific rules regarding the execution and recording of quitclaim deeds. The deed must be signed by all grantors and notarized. Additionally, it must be filed with the local registry of deeds to be effective against third parties. New Hampshire law does not require a quitclaim deed to be witnessed, but notarization is essential. It is also important to check for any local regulations that may affect the filing process or requirements.
